يرشدك هذا البرنامج التعليمي إلى كيفية إضافة دائرة إلى PDF باستخدام واجهة برمجة تطبيقات Node.js REST. ستتعلم كيفية رسم دائرة تلقائيًا على ملف PDF باستخدام واجهة برمجة تطبيقات تعتمد على Node.js باستخدام حزمة تطوير برمجيات سحابية تعتمد على Node.js. كما يوفر البرنامج التعليمي تفاصيل لتخصيص الدائرة وفقًا لاحتياجاتك.
متطلب أساسي
- {{الرابط التشعبي 1}}
- قم بتنزيل مجموعة أدوات تطوير البرامج السحابية Aspose.PDF لـ Node.js لإضافة دائرة في ملف PDF
- إعداد مشروع Node.js باستخدام SDK أعلاه للعمل مع تعليقات الدائرة
خطوات رسم دائرة في ملف PDF باستخدام واجهة Node.js REST
- قم بتكوين كائن فئة PdfApi عن طريق تعيين تفاصيل واجهة برمجة التطبيقات والتطبيق
- قم بإنشاء كائن CircleAnnotation وحدد المنطقة المستطيلة للدائرة واللون
- قم بتعيين تواريخ التعديل والإنشاء لأنها إلزامية
- قم بتحميل ملف PDF المستهدف إلى وحدة التخزين السحابية لإضافة دائرة
- اتصل بطريقة تعليقات دائرة صفحة المنشور لرسم الدائرة في المستطيل المحدد
- قم بتنزيل ملف PDF المحدث الذي يحتوي على الدائرة الموجودة فيه
توضح هذه الخطوات كيفية إدراج دائرة في ملف PDF باستخدام واجهة برمجة تطبيقات Node.js REST. CircleAnnotation هو الكائن الرئيسي الذي يُحدد تنسيق الدائرة، مثل أبعادها وموقعها ولونها، إلخ. حمّل ملف PDF المستهدف إلى وحدة التخزين السحابية، وحدد تاريخي الإنشاء والتعديل، ثم استدعِ دالة PostPageCircleAnnotations() لرسم الدائرة.
كود إضافة دائرة في PDF باستخدام خدمة Node.js RESTful
يوضح هذا الكود كيفية إضافة دائرة إلى ملف PDF باستخدام واجهة برمجة تطبيقات Node.js منخفضة الكود. يمكنك تكرار هذه العملية برسم دوائر متعددة على الصفحة نفسها أو على صفحات متعددة باستخدام أرقام صفحات مختلفة في دالة PostPageCircleAnnotations(). يمكن رسم دوائر متعددة باستدعاء واحد فقط لهذه الدالة، حيث إنها تستقبل قائمة من التعليقات التوضيحية التي يمكن إضافة أكثر من مدخل إليها.
علّمتنا هذه المقالة رسم دائرة على ملف PDF. إذا كنت ترغب في تحديد جزء من صفحة PDF، يُرجى مراجعة المقالة تسليط الضوء على مستند PDF باستخدام Node.js REST API.